Daphne, AL vs Lawton, OK
Cost of Living Comparison
Lawton, OK is more affordable by 8.7 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Daphne, AL | Lawton, OK |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 94.7 | 85.9 | +8.7 |
| Housing | 89.2 | 57.4 | +31.8 |
| Goods | 96.4 | 93.8 | +2.6 |
| Utilities | 83.3 | 73.0 | +10.3 |
| Other Services | 96.7 | 95.5 | +1.2 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Daphne, AL | Lawton, OK |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$71,039 | $57,196 |
| Median Home Value | $266,000 | $143,200 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$1,160 | $898 |
| Per Capita Income | $38,907 | $30,068 |
